  • How do I change an iCloud account on an iPad?

    My iPhone and iPad use 2 distinct iCloud accounts, as a by product of the mobile me exit. Now I want to sync these 2 devices, so they need to use the same iCloud account. When I start to change the iPad account, I receive a dire warning that all data in iCloud and the iPad will be lost if I proceed.
    Is the warning untrue, or am I misreading it, or am i going about this incorrectly? How should one change the iCloud account on an iPad to another existing iCloud account? Thanks for any help anyone can provide.
    vr/rick.36n.121w

    It does delete it from you iPad but not from the iCloud account.  If you want to migrate the data to a different iCloud account first go to Settings>iCloud on your iPad and turn all synced data to Off, when prompted choose to keep the data on your iPad.  When everything is turned off you can scroll to the bottom and tap Delete Account.  Then set up the other iCloud account on your iPad and turn syncing back on for contacts, calendars, etc. When prompted choose merge to upload the data and merge it with any data on this account.

  • How do i change the icloud account on my iphone to a different existing account

    I have a business iPhone 5S on which the iTunes account is associated with the Apple ID I signed up for using my business e-mail. I signed in to iCloud with a personal Apple ID account to get some of my personal music onto the device. I have been trying to find out how to change the iCloud account to my business Apple ID. I'd like to be able to switch back and forth if I want. I have read several posts that advise deleting the iCloud account, but I still have personal devices I would like to continue to use with this Apple ID and iCloud account. The extent of the deletion is not addressed.
    If I use the delete account under iCloud, does that delete it from the device, or does it delete it permanently? Tried adding my business email to the iCloud account, but it won't let me because it is associated with another Apple ID (duh). Am I stuck here?
    iPhone 5S, iOS 8.1 - just updated.
    The only option under iCloud is "Sign Out"

    Deleting an iCloud account only deletes it from the Device, not from iCloud.  In iOS 8, the name of this setting changed to "Sign Out" as that is a better reflection of what actually happens.  Your iCloud data remains on the server, available to devices still signed into the account, but the device you sign out of the account on is disconnected from the account, and as a result, the iCloud data from that account is removed from the device.  It will redownload to the device should you sign back into the account.
    The only issue you'll run into when you switch between accounts is with my photo stream photos older than 30 days.  When you delete (or sign out of) and account, your photo stream photos are deleted along with the other data from the account in question.  However, unlike other data which remains on the server and can redownload to your device when you sign back in, my photo stream photos only remain in iCloud for 30 days.  When you sign back in, you will only get back my photo stream photos added in the last 30 days (as older photos are no longer in iCloud to redownload).  Like other account data, any my photo stream photos on your other devices signed into the account are unaffected by this.  If you want to keep older my photo stream photos on your device as you change iCloud accounts, save them to your camera roll before deleting (signing out of) the account.
